Job description

We are se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Administrative Assistant to join our team. The ideal candidate will have experience in answering phones, filing, typing, customer service, completing paperwork, and property management. This individual will play a key role in ensuring the smooth operation of our office.

Responsibilities:
  • Answering phones and directing calls to the appropriate person
  • Filing and organizing documents
  • Typing correspondence and reports
  • Providing excellent customer service to clients and visitors
  • Completing paperwork accurately and in a timely manner
  • Utilizing property management experience to assist with various tasks
Requirements:
  • Previous experience in an administrative role
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office suite
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ize tasks effectively
  • Strong attention to detail
  • Property management experience is a plus
